Expert: Prince Harry’s Defense of Memoir Worries Palace

-

Prince Harry’s recent actions following his visit to the UK have raised concerns at the Palace, as per an expert’s analysis. While in London, Harry met with his father, the King, marking their first in-person meeting in over a year. Subsequently, he traveled to Ukraine to meet with injured soldiers, where he addressed his controversial memoir. In an interview, Harry defended his book, stating it aimed to correct existing narratives and that he did not intend to expose personal matters publicly.

Royal correspondent Jennie Bond suggested that Harry should have refrained from commenting on his book during the interview, focusing instead on his visit to Ukraine. Bond highlighted that Harry’s insistence on justifying his actions could potentially strain his relationship with the royal family, particularly his brother Prince William, who values privacy and discretion. She emphasized the importance of trust and discretion in family dynamics, indicating that Harry has a long way to go to rebuild his brother’s trust.

Bond’s remarks suggest that while Harry’s statements may not severely impact his relationship with his father, they could hinder any potential reconciliation with Prince William.
